Planting 100,000 Ponderosa Pine Seedlings in the “Pine Forest”

Nebraska Forest Service celebrated the NASF #CentennialChallenge by planting 100,000 ponderosa pine seedlings in the “pine forest.”

Ponderosa pine is native tree species across much of the western United States, including western Nebraska. It is a fairly fast-growing tree and has been a popular choice across the state for windbreaks and general landscape use.
